Output 5c66a7b7326091f77ad9f25dfef7b5ee1bc6b81cb6ab8ae5e6320594cf6f5039:0

value
15987570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 468aa43c50074c6cea7b5d35e0e5ea48c8082094 OP_EQUALVERIFY OP_CHECKSIG
address
17RzPQsY4bRXWCgx8yzu8Ww8JMiVpXqA8C
transaction
5c66a7b7326091f77ad9f25dfef7b5ee1bc6b81cb6ab8ae5e6320594cf6f5039
confirmations
479798
spent
true